But we can do this too, albeit, in the emotional punch factor. Instead of simply buying Betty Crocker’s finest for your friend’s upcoming birthday, add a little something to it and watch your networth soar. Here’s what I did:

PINEAPPLE COCONUT BIRTHDAY CAKE
-Buy vanilla cake mix
-Add a can of crushed pineapple to the regular directions
-Generously sprinkle flaked coconut to the top of the frosting
Result: Pure gourmet awesome for less than two dollars more.
